ABSTRACT:
View this webcast to learn what's new in BlackBerry Enterprise Server v4.1 with Service Pack 5 for Microsoft Exchange. New features reviewed include:

  • Remote email search and download
  • Free/busy lookup
  • Native file email attachment download
  • Remote "calendar reconcile" command
  • Support for attachments in messages encrypted with S/MIME or PGP
